By a News Reporter-Staff News Editor at Robotics & Machine Learning DailyNews Daily News-A new study on artificial intelligence is now available. According to news originatingfrom Tianjin, People's Republic of China, by NewsRx correspondents, research stated, "To predict thebehavior o f aromatic contaminants (ACs) in complex soil-plant systems, this study develope d machine learning (ML) models to estimate the root concentration factor (RCF) o f both traditional (e.g., polycyclicaromatic hydrocarbons, polychlorinated biph enyls) and emerging ACs (e.g., phthalate acid esters, arylorganophosphate ester s)."Funders for this research include The Major Scientific And Technological Innovat ion Project of ShandongProvince.
